Προς το περιεχόμενο

Αρχειοθετημένο

Αυτό το θέμα έχει αρχειοθετηθεί και είναι κλειστό για περαιτέρω απαντήσεις.

  • 0
Dober

Απορια με Access plz Help

Ερώτηση

παιδια καλησπέρα, έχω κάνει με βάση στην οποια θέλω να καταχωρώ καποια δεδομένα σε μια φορμα και μετα με ενα κουμπί εντολής να μου εμφανίζει την εκθεση την οποία έχω φτιάξει ως εδω όλα καλα, το προβλημα είναι οτι οταν πατάω το κουμπί δεν μου εμφανίζει τα δεδομένα τις εγγραφής που ειμουνα αλλα μου εμφανίζει την 1η εγγραφή ενω εγώ πατησα το κουμπί οταν είμουν στην εγγραφή νουμερο 5.

πως γίνεται να μου βγάζει την εγγραφή που βλεπω εκείνη την ώρα στην φορμα???? plz help

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ες

8 απαντήσεις σε αυτή την ερώτηση

Προτεινόμενες αναρτήσεις

Ο κώδικας αυτός πρέπει να μπει στη φόρμα και συγκεκριμένα στο συμβάν 'με το κλικ' του κουμπιού που πατάς προκειμένου να εμφανίσεις την αναφορά που έχεις φτιάξει για την τρέχουσα εγγραφή της φόρμας.

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ες

πιο πάνω που μου περιγράφεις την συνταξη του κωδικα μιλας μονο για ενα πεδιο ενω εγο στην εκθεση εχω παραπανω πεδια πως πρεπει να να συνταχθει ωστε να βαλω όλα τα πεδια που εχω?

 

πχ. στην φορμα συμπληρώνω "επώνυμο, ονομα, διευθυνση, τηλέφωνο, κινητό" και αλλα μπορεις εαν γίνεται να μου φερεις ενα παράδειγμα?

 

ευχαριστώ.

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ες

Θέλω κάποιων να που να γνωρίζει την access να του στείλω ένα αρχείο και να μου πει πως δεν μπορώ να κάνω κάτι πρόσθεσης από την δευτερεύουσα φόρμα στην κυρία φόρμα .

Και επίσης να μου πει πως μπορώ να την κάνω την εφαρμογή αυτόνομη να μην ανοίγει μέσα από την access αλλά με εικονίδιο. [email protected]

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ες

Dim stDocName As String

Dim stLinkCriteria As String

stDocName = "ΌνομαΈκθεσης"

stLinkCriteria = "[ΌνομαΠεδίουΈκθεσης]=" & Me![ΌνομαControlΦόρμας] (αν πρόκειται για αριθμό)

ή

stLinkCriteria = "[ΌνομαΠεδίουΈκθεσης]=""" & Me![ΌνομαControlΦόρμας] & """" (αν πρόκειται για κείμενο)

DoCmd.OpenReport stDocName, acViewPreview, , stLinkCriteria

To [ΌνομαΠεδίουΈκθεσης] είναι το όνομα του πεδίου του πίνακα ή του ερωτήματος που αποτελεί την πρόελευση εγγραφών της έκθεσης που θέλεις να ταιριάζει με την τιμή που περιέχεται στο [ΌνομαControlΦόρμας].

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ες

σ'ευχαριστώ για την απάντηση σου αλλα το προβλημα ειναι οτι δεν ξέρω που να τον γράψω αυτο τον κώδικα που μου δίνεις, τι εννοώ: θα τον γράψω στην φόρμα ή στην έκθεση και που ακριβός?

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ες

Δεν θα χρησιμοποιήσεις όλα αυτά τα πεδία στα κριτήρια. Υποθετικά τώρα.. Η φόρμα σου έχει προέλευση εγγραφών έναν πίνακα. Ο πίνακας έχει ένα βασικό κλειδί . Το βασικό κλειδί έχει ένα όνομα [ΌνομαΠεδίουΈκθεσης]. Η φόρμα σου έχει ένα πλαίσιο κειμένου που εμφανίζει το βασικό κλειδί που μάλλον στην περίπτωση σου πρόκειται γιά ένα πεδίο αυτόματης αρίθμησης. Το πλαίσιο κειμένου έχει ένα όνομα [ΌνομαControlΦόρμας].

Dim stDocName As String

Dim stLinkCriteria As String

stDocName = "ΌνομαΈκθεσης"

stLinkCriteria = "[ΌνομαΠεδίουΈκθεσης]=" & Me![ΌνομαControlΦόρμας]

DoCmd.OpenReport stDocName, acViewPreview, , stLinkCriteria

Κοινοποιήστε αυτήν την ανάρτηση


Σύνδεσμος στην ανάρτηση
Κοινοποίηση σε άλλες σελίδες
×
×
  • Δημιουργία νέου...